II. Common failure modes and diagnostic methods
1. Power attenuation or no output (accounting for 60% of faults)
Possible causes:
Pump laser attenuation aging (typical consumption of 15,000 hours)
Photonic crystal fiber (PCF) end face damage/damage
Spectral combiner (Split unit) relief
Detection steps:
Spectral analysis:
Use a spectrometer to check the output of each band. If a certain output segment points to a complete failure of the Split module
Pump power test:
Disconnect the PCF and directly measure the pump laser power (if it is 10% lower than the nominal value, the switch needs to be replaced)
Fiber end face inspection:
Observe the PCF end face with a 100x microscope. Black spots or cracks require professional polishing
2. Abnormal spectral shape
Typical manifestations:
Short-wave end (<600nm) power drops suddenly → PCF micro-bend
Periodic spikes appear → Stimulated Brillouin Fall (SBS) in the fiber
Solution:
PCF freezing optimization:
Re-fix the fiber to ensure that the bending radius is >10cm (the SPLIT bracket requires a special clamp)
Pump pulse parameter adjustment:
Reduce the maximum power or increase the pulse width to suppress SBS (NKT software permission required)

IV. Preventive maintenance plan
Monthly inspection
Record the power ratio of each band (deviation >5% requires warning)
Clean the air cooling filter (clogging will cause pump overheating)
Annual maintenance
Replace the PCF interface seal (anti-moisture overview)
Re-adjust the power sensor (standard probe comparison)
